Visa has announced that it will roll out contactless cards nationwide in the UK. The roll out is to start next year in the London region. The decision was taken unanimously by the Visa UK board of Directors.

Visa are to keep the GBP10 maximum threshold for transactions using the contactless method only. Sandra Alzetta, Visa Europe Senior Vice President Consumer Market Development, said: "With over 75% of all cash payments being less than GBP10, the introduction of contactless payments will play a major role in encouraging the use of cards over cash for low value transactions.
